The Design Quality Lead (DQL) for BCIM is responsible for driving design quality excellence from early concept through launch. This role ensures alignment to quality targets, leads APQP/PPAP readiness, manages risk, and provides cross‑functional leadership to engineering, suppliers, and program teams. The DQL Project Specialist plays a critical role in ensuring robust design execution, early issue identification, and quality convergence to meet customer and business expectations.

Key Responsibilities:

Early Engagement & Quality Target Convergence:

  • Begin involvement 4 weeks before PM or upon A3Q release from CX.
  • Lead quality convergence toward NA BCIM targets for Months in Service and CPV.
  • Conduct Gap-to-Target assessments and identify risks requiring engineering or leadership action.
  • Collaborate with Engineering and TECH teams to define enablers needed to close quality gaps.
  • Train engineering teams on applying Quality Targets during the RFQ process.

Design Quality Process Initiation & Governance:

Ensure all design-related checkpoints are Green or Orange with action plans, including:

  • Design Assessment
  • Risk Management Plan
  • Lessons Learned (Check Retex) review

Project Review & Leadership Communication:

  • Prepare and deliver bi‑weekly project reviews with the Director.
  • Develop and present materials for senior leadership reviews.
  • Attend weekly PMT meetings and other cross-functional sessions as needed.
  • Participate in part readiness meetings and provide design-quality input related to APQP.

APQP / PPAP Monitoring & Execution:

  • Monitor APQP and PPAP progress across assigned components and suppliers.
  • Initiate APQP kickoff meetings with DRE, SQE, and suppliers.
  • Support and help lead technical review meetings to ensure TECH teams and DQLs understand APQP expectations and cadence.
  • Provide weekly APQP status reports to the Project CVE.
  • Conduct weekly APQP grid audits and escalate issues when necessary.

Level 1 Escalation Management:

  • Initiate escalation notifications to the Project Lead and Quality Project Specialist; maintain the escalation report.
  • Lead escalation meetings with Buyer, SQE, Supplier, DRE, SSTM, and SSTL as needed to resolve roadblocks.

Training & Capability Building:

  • Deliver introductory APQP/PPAP training sessions for engineering and supplier teams.
  • Host bi‑weekly APQP Process and AUROS/PLM Q&A workshops for DREs, SSTMs, SSTLs, SQEs, suppliers, and extended functional teams.
  • Provide 1:1 AUROS/PLM training for DREs to ensure proper system usage and documentation quality.
